A Simple Key For c programming assignment help Unveiled



C does not have a Particular provision for declaring multi-dimensional arrays, but fairly depends on recursion inside the type process to declare arrays of arrays, which effectively accomplishes the identical point.

In C This is certainly performed by presenting the 'non-public variety' for a void* which means that you cannot know just about anything about it, but implies that no one can do any kind of sort checking on it. In C++ we could ahead declare lessons and so present an anonymous class sort.

C supports the use of tips, a kind of reference that records the address or area of an item or operate in memory. Tips may be dereferenced to obtain data saved with the deal with pointed to, or to invoke a pointed-to operate. Tips is usually manipulated making use of assignment or pointer arithmetic. The run-time illustration of a pointer benefit is typically a raw memory handle (Maybe augmented by an offset-within just-word subject), but since a pointer's variety incorporates the kind of the thing pointed to, expressions including pointers might be form-checked at compile time.

specified, even on the extent that if we determine a parameter of type Hours24 we can't assign a worth of Hrs Although it could only be while in the vary.

The Edition of C that it describes is usually called K&R C. The 2nd version on the book[sixteen] covers the later on ANSI C normal, explained under.

Ada presents two optional key phrases to specify how parameters are passed, out and in. These are employed such as this:

That is a must have when performing numeric intensive functions and plan to port the program, you define precisely the sort you'll need, not what you believe may possibly do currently.

A variety of tools happen to be produced to help C programmers discover and correct statements with undefined behavior or maybe erroneous expressions, with bigger rigor than that furnished by the compiler. The Resource lint was the initial these kinds of, leading to a lot of Other people.

System five.three illustrates the assignment operator. Discover that in the road side=three; the side is within the remaining hand side from the = . The still left facet in the assignment specifies the deal with into which the information transfer will take place. Then again, if we were to wrote region=side; the facet is on the appropriate hand side from the = . The proper side of the assignment assertion will Examine into Clicking Here a value, which specifies the info for being transferred.

Myhomeworkdone.com is here for anybody seeking a far better placement in everyday life and we gained’t prevent until eventually you can get exactly what you’re in search of inside of a homework assistance assistance.

We are going to use C Within this course for 2 explanations. 1st, throughout the last 10 yrs, it's ranked a couple of out of all large-degree languages. Next, C is by far the most common language for composing program for embedded techniques.

Another function is shown, for Several hours We've got claimed we wish to restrict an Integer sort to your offered variety, for the subsequent two We have now asked the compiler to

Ada also gives two features which is able to be recognized by C++ useful content programmers, quite possibly not by C programmers, and a 3rd I don't understand how C does without: Overloading Ada makes it possible for more than one operate/technique Together with the very same title providing

, ?: plus the comma operator). This permits a large degree of object code optimization through the compiler, but needs C programmers to acquire additional care to acquire reliable final results than is read what he said needed for other programming languages.

Leave a Reply

Your email address will not be published. Required fields are marked *